Overview
The SZNUP2125WTT3G is an ESD protection diode designed by onsemi to protect CAN and LIN transceivers from ESD and other harmful transient voltage events. This device offers bidirectional protection for each data line within a single compact SC-70 (SOT-323) package, providing a cost-effective solution for enhancing system reliability and meeting stringent EMI requirements.
Key Specifications
Parameter | Value | Unit |
---|---|---|
Peak Power Dissipation per Line | 200 | W (8/20 μs waveform) |
Reverse Working Voltage (VRWM) | 24 | V |
Breakdown Voltage (VBR) | 27 - 32 | V (IT = 1 mA) |
Reverse Leakage Current (IR) | < 100 | nA (VRWM = 24 V) |
Clamping Voltage (VC) | 33.4 - 36.6 | V (IPP = 1 A, 8/20 μs waveform) |
Maximum Peak Pulse Current (IPP) | 3.0 | A (8/20 μs waveform) |
Capacitance (CJ) | 7.0 - 10 | pF (VR = 0 V, f = 1 MHz) |
Operating Junction Temperature Range | -55 to 150 | °C |
Storage Temperature Range | -55 to 150 | °C |
Lead Solder Temperature | 260 | °C (10 s) |
Package Type | SC-70 (SOT-323) | |
Flammability Rating | UL 94 V-0 |
Key Features
- Bidirectional protection for each data line
- Compact SC-70 (SOT-323) package
- 200 W peak power dissipation per line (8/20 μs waveform)
- Diode capacitance matching
- Low reverse leakage current (< 100 nA)
- IEC compatibility: IEC 61000-4-2 (ESD): Level 4, IEC 61000-4-4 (EFT): 50 A (5/50 ns), IEC 61000-4-5 (Lightning): 3.0 A (8/20 μs)
- ISO 7637 compliance: Non-repetitive EMI surge pulse 2, 8.0 A (1/50 μs) and repetitive EFT EMI surge pulses, 50 A (5/50 ns)
- AEC-Q101 qualified and PPAP capable
- Pb-free devices
Applications
- Automotive networks: CAN / CAN-FD, Low and High-Speed CAN, Fault Tolerant CAN, LIN
- Automotive IVN
